\n27 Bridge Street Hawick
\nAt No 27 is the long-established Deans Chartered Accountants, formerly the premises of Waverley Housing. In the 1950s it was the London, Liverpool and Globe Insurance Company, and then the practice of Dr. R. M. McGregor, Langlee, who had served with the Medical Corps during the Second World War. In the 1960s he was joined at the surgery by Drs. Hugh MacMaster and Rory Hamilton (grandson of Dr. John Hamilton) whom had both previously practised in the annexe of the Elm House.<\/span><\/p>\n
